Mrs. Smith 81, of Meridian passed away Tuesday, July 30, 2019 at Laird Hospital in Union, MS.
Mrs. Smith was a member of Oak Hill Baptist Church where she was a longtime dedicated Sunday School Teacher, Choir Member, and servant in all areas needed. She was the former secretary at Oakland Heights Baptist Church (Now Oak Hill Baptist Church), Mississippi Chemical and The Lauderdale County Juvenile Center where she retired. She was an avid reader and enjoyed baking and cooking for family whenever possible. She enjoyed gardening and crocheting in her spare time. She was affectionately known as “Mawmaw” by her grandchildren, great-grandchild and one great-grandchild on the way, all whom she loved dearly.
